Output cfeb8784d081cc6097752bc823ae09cb75cd415809ff955aa042548cac045bea:6

value
3395006
script pubkey
OP_0 OP_PUSHBYTES_20 f7888ca38700885196ed16ae4bb9f7821849f025
address
bc1q77ygegu8qzy9r9hdz6hyhw0hsgvynup9cwhs69
transaction
cfeb8784d081cc6097752bc823ae09cb75cd415809ff955aa042548cac045bea
confirmations
74590
spent
true